Monthly Cost of Living
😐A single person spends $2,017 per month in Germany vs $204 in Bhutan, rent included.
😐A couple spends around $3,049 per month in Germany vs $314 in Bhutan, rent included.
😐A family of three spends $4,081 per month in Germany vs $424 in Bhutan, rent included.
😐Germany costs about 889% more than Bhutan on average – the gap runs across housing, groceries, transport, and services.
📊Germany sits 51% above the global median, while Bhutan is 85% below – they fall on opposite sides of the world average.

Cost Breakdown
🏠Average rent: $846 in Germany vs $85.0 in Bhutan. For reference, capital cities sit at $1,410 in Berlin and $118 in Thimphu.
💰Average salary: $3,209 in Germany vs $393 in Bhutan. The income gap affects purchasing power and how far your budget stretches in each country.
